RAVEN VICE PRESIDENT INTERVIEWED BY CBS 12 NEWS AFTER ARREST OF THREE SUSPECTS IN CHILD SEXUAL ABUSE CASE

Raven was approached yesterday by CBS 12 News to speak about the mission of our organization. During a report about the arrest of three suspects in a child sexual abuse case in Palm Beach County, Florida, Brent Gromer, Raven Board Vice President, spoke with Luli Ortiz and explained the approach that Raven are taking to strengthen legislation by lobbying in DC and gain much needed funding to ensure that ICAC teams across the nation are able to investigate the increasing number of online crimes against children cases. The ultimate goal to bring these perpetrators to justice.
